stopgap
Adjective

stopgap (not comparable)

  1. Filling a gap or pause.
  2. Temporary; short-term.
    They put a stopgap solution in place, but need something more permanent.
Noun

stopgap (plural stopgaps)

  1. That which fills a gap or hiatus.
  2. (figuratively) A temporary measure or short-term fix used until something better can be obtained; that which serves as an expedient in an emergency; a band-aid solution.
    The small company uses their old product with a few kludged enhancements as a stopgap until they can develop a new product.
